Jalapeño Jack Cheese Dip (For When You Need Something That Actually Has Flavor)

  • Yield:6 servings
  • Time:
    12 mins show details

Ingredients

  • 8 ounces
    jalapeño jack cheese, shredded
  • ½ cup
    sour cream
  • ¼ cup
    mayonnaise
  • gar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ons
    pimiento, chopped
  • 2
    green onions, chopped
  • ¼ cup
    sunflower seeds, toasted

Preparation

  1. Mix the shredded cheese, sour cream, mayonnaise, and minced garlic in a microwave-safe bowl until well combined.

  2. 7 mins

    Microwave uncovered on high for 7 minutes, stirring every 2 minutes to prevent hot spots and ensure even melting. Alternatively, bake at 350°F for 20 minutes. (The microwave method is faster but requires more attention - cheese can go from melted to rubbery quickly.)

  3. Stir in half of the chopped pimiento, green onions, and sunflower seeds.

  4. 5 mins

    Continue microwaving for 2-3 more minutes on high, or bake for an additional 5 minutes until bubbly.

  5. Garnish with the remaining pimiento, green onions, and sunflower seeds.

  6. Serve immediately with tortilla chips or kerupuk if you want to be interesting.

Notes

This keeps in the fridge for up to a week and reheats well. Just stir thoroughly after reheating - the oils tend to separate. Not exactly Indonesian, but sometimes you need something for the office potluck that won't scare your coworkers.
